Job DetailsJob Location: Colorado Remote - Denver, CO 80203Position Type: Full TimeSalary Range: $90,000.00 - $105,000.00 Salary/yearJob Category: ManagementSummary The Regional Service Manager is responsible for the overall performance of the assigned territory, including revenue growth, profitability, technician development, and customer satisfaction. This role combines strategic leadership with hands-on technical oversight. The manager develops long-term client relationships, expands the service area to gain new customers, and ensures the company remains competitive by servicing both proprietary and competitive equipment. The position also drives process improvement, technician skill development, and execution of the strategic direction of field operations. This is a remote, field-based role covering a designated region, with travel required up to 60% of the time. Roles & Responsibilities
